目前许多大城市正大力推进地铁建设项目,地铁施工将不可避免地下穿城市老旧建筑群。大多数老旧房屋结构现状较差,房屋设计资料收集困难,居住人员密集且关系复杂,甚至有部分房屋所有人持有希望得以拆迁或赔偿的诉求。如何保障地铁施工时上部房屋的安全、减少纠纷和不必要的经济赔偿、避免延误工期等,往往成为需要首先解决的问题。以成都某在建地铁穿越老旧房屋建筑群为背景,通过进行施工前的房屋鉴定,穿越施工前场地振动测试试验,施工过程建筑群沉降模拟分析等方面工作,并分析总结经验以供类似工程参考。
At present, many big cities are vigorously promoting metro construction projects, metro construction will inevitably go through the urban old buildings. Most of the old buildings have poor structural status, it is difficult to collect design data, it exists intensive residential and complex relationship, and even some owners have the desire to be removed or compensated. How to ensure the safety of the superstructure, reduce disputes and unnecessary economic compensation, and avoid delays in the construction of metro often become the first problem to be solved. Based on the background of a metro construction projects in Chengdu crossing old buildings, the experience of similar projects was analyzed and summarized for reference through building appraisal and site vibration test before construction, settlement simulation analysis during construction.
